  "details" : [ "The rtps_util_add_bitmap function in epan/dissectors/packet-rtps.c in the RTPS dissector in Wireshark 1.6.x before 1.6.13 and 1.8.x before 1.8.5 does not properly implement certain nested loops for processing bitmap data,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(infinite loop) via a malformed packet." ],
  "statement" : "Not Vulnerable. This issue does not affect the version of wireshark as shipped with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5 and 6.",
